1964 Maserati Mistral vs. 1962 Nissan Cedric

To start off, 1964 Maserati Mistral is newer by 2 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1962 Nissan Cedric.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1962 Nissan Cedric would be higher. At 3,694 cc (6 cylinders), 1964 Maserati Mistral is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1964 Maserati Mistral (243 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 183 more horse power than 1962 Nissan Cedric. (60 HP @ 5000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1964 Maserati Mistral should accelerate faster than 1962 Nissan Cedric.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1964 Maserati Mistral weights approximately 320 kg more than 1962 Nissan Cedric.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
